From d95eacd3851a20e52202465ec22b4f72a4983dc8 Mon Sep 17 00:00:00 2001 From: Carl Hetherington Date: Mon, 11 Jan 2021 00:16:40 +0100 Subject: Replace std::list with std::vector in the API. --- examples/read_dcp.cc | 16 ++++++++-------- 1 file changed, 8 insertions(+), 8 deletions(-) (limited to 'examples/read_dcp.cc') diff --git a/examples/read_dcp.cc b/examples/read_dcp.cc index 6a36d009..9c6c307a 100644 --- a/examples/read_dcp.cc +++ b/examples/read_dcp.cc @@ -58,21 +58,21 @@ main () } std::cout << "DCP has " << dcp.cpls().size() << " CPLs.\n"; - std::list > assets = dcp.assets (); + auto assets = dcp.assets (); std::cout << "DCP has " << assets.size() << " assets.\n"; - for (std::list >::const_iterator i = assets.begin(); i != assets.end(); ++i) { - if (std::dynamic_pointer_cast (*i)) { + for (auto i: assets) { + if (std::dynamic_pointer_cast(i)) { std::cout << "2D picture\n"; - } else if (std::dynamic_pointer_cast (*i)) { + } else if (std::dynamic_pointer_cast(i)) { std::cout << "3D picture\n"; - } else if (std::dynamic_pointer_cast (*i)) { + } else if (std::dynamic_pointer_cast(i)) { std::cout << "Sound\n"; - } else if (std::dynamic_pointer_cast (*i)) { + } else if (std::dynamic_pointer_cast(i)) { std::cout << "Subtitle\n"; - } else if (std::dynamic_pointer_cast (*i)) { + } else if (std::dynamic_pointer_cast(i)) { std::cout << "CPL\n"; } - std::cout << "\t" << (*i)->file()->leaf().string() << "\n"; + std::cout << "\t" << i->file()->leaf().string() << "\n"; } /* Take the first CPL */ -- cgit v1.2.3